For background and to file new issues, please use the Testbot queue. We'll move it to other modules as necessary.
This is the module that takes patches posted in the Drupal.org issue queue and sends them off to qa.drupal.org for dispatch to testbots.
It provides Project module integration for PIFR (qa.drupal.org). The integration serves to make automated testing and review part of the development workflow without requiring effort on behalf of the developer.
Information transfer
All requests and data transmissions are sent using the XML-RPC protocol defined by PIFR. Cron is used to trigger the XML-RPC communication and as such there is a short lag time between the event occurring and the time it has been completely processed.
Triggers
Testing is performed, if all criteria are met, when a commit is made or a patch is posted on an issue. The commits will trigger testing of their respective branches and the patches will trigger testing of the related branch with the patch applied. In the future testing of releases may be supported.
Display
Results are displayed along side the attachments in the issue queue, but there is currently no way to see the testing results for a branch except via PIFR. Displaying the results on project pages is something that will be supported in the future.
Related documentation
Automated Testing Infrastructure and How to deploy a testbot
Related repositories
Project Issue File Test, Project Issue File Review, drupaltestbot-puppet, drupaltestbot
Maintainer
The project has been developed and is maintained by Jimmy Berry (boombatower).
Downloads
Recommended releases
Development releases
Project Information
- Maintenance status: Actively maintained
- Development status: Under active development
- Module categories: Developer, Utility
- Reported installs: 4 sites currently report using this module. View usage statistics.
- Last modified: January 24, 2012